POWER button on the remote control your television will be left unattended press D On Off button to turn your television off Troubleshooting Before Contacting Service Personnel Before contacting Samsung after sales service perform the following simple checks If you cannot solve the problem using the instructions below note the model and serial number of the television and contact your local dealer No sound or picture Normal picture but no sound 9 9 9 99 Check that the mains lead has been connected to a wall socket Check that you have pressed the button On Off and the POWER button Check the picture contrast and brightness settings Check the volume Check the volume Check whether the MUTE lt button on the remote control has been pressed No picture or black and white picture Adjust the color settings Check that the broadcast system selected is correct Sound and picture interference Try to identify the electrical appliance that is affecting the television then move it further away Plug your television into a different mains socket Blurred or snowy picture distorted sound e 9 99 Check the direction location and connections of your aerial This interference often occurs due to the use of an indoor aerial Remote control malfunctions Replace the remote control batteries Clean the upper edge of the remote control tr

26. be used When both the side AV and rear connectors are connected to external equipments the side AV receives priority When both the AV IN 3 Video IN and S VIDEO are connected to external equipment the S VIDEO receives priority Viewing Pictures From External Sources Once you have connected up your various audio and video systems you can view different sources by selecting the appropriate input 1 Check that all the necessary connections have been made 2 Switch your television on then press the SOURCE button repeatedly Result The input sources are displayed in the following order AV1 AV2 AV3 S Video Component1 Component2 gt gt Depending the source selected the pictures may appear automatically gt gt watch television programmes again press the TV CC button and select the number of the channel required English 44 Automatic Degaussing to Remove Color Patches A degaussing coil is mounted around the picture tube so you do not normally need to degauss the television manually If you move the television to a different position and color patches appear on the screen you must Switch the television off by pressing the On Off button on the front panel Unplug the television from the wall socket Leave the television power off for about 30 minutes so that the automatic degauss function can be activated and then press the
